Trust and Estate Tax Supervisor
Job Description
Withum’s Tax Services Group is comprised of tax specialists who ensure accurate and timely tax reporting while minimizing or deferring tax payments. They provide comprehensive tax strategies across international, US federal, state, and local regulations, including working with HLB international. Their services cover Business, Individual, State & Local tax, R&D Tax Credit, and International and Private Client services. You will lead audit engagements, supervise staff, and build client relationships.
Responsibilities
- Review complex gift, estate, and fiduciary income tax returns, including related schedules and forms
- Review fiduciary accountings for estates and trusts
- Provide tax planning and consulting to high net worth clients for estate and individual income taxes
- Research and consult on various estate, gift, and trust-related issues, such as trustee and beneficiary issues, Crummey obligations, and generation skipping tax issues
- Identify additional estate and income tax planning opportunities for clients
- Manage, coach, and mentor staff, seniors, and supervisors
- Research and draft memoranda involving complex tax matters
- Identify and implement tax planning opportunities
- Oversee complete tax research projects for a variety of clients and diverse industries
- Manage multiple engagements concurrently with various teams to meet client deadlines
- Conduct constructive discussions with team members on evaluations and provide counsel
- Serve in professional development programs as an instructor or discussion leader
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in accounting, preferably a Master's of Science in Taxation
- CPA License (preferred)
- At least 4 years of public accounting experience
- Exceptional client service and communication skills with a demonstrated ability to develop and maintain outstanding client relationships
- Strong leadership, training, and mentoring skills, coupled with excellent verbal, written, and presentation skills to represent the Firm well to client’s management
- Excellent analytical, organizational, project management skills, strong attention to detail, and proven innovative problem-solving skills
- Ability to travel as needed based on client assignments
